Major Assembly of First Boeing 787 Dreamliner Starts

Analysis

Nagoya (BOEING) - Boeing [NYSE: BA] and its partner Fuji Heavy Industries (FHI) today celebrate the start of major assembly for the first 787 Dreamliner. FHI began to assemble the center wing section at its new factory in Handa, Japan, near Nagoya.
